Teacher of Geography job summary

The King's Academy are looking to recruit a Teacher of Geography (0.4-0.6FTE) who will enthuse pupils to learn with a combination of great subject knowledge, energy and dedication.

The geography department provides education to all students in Key Stage 3 with roughly half of each cohort studying the subject to GCSE. The department also offers A level geography. The department is led by the Head of Department and operates from four classrooms in our newest extension to the school, opened in January 2023. The department offers a range of field trips across year groups in the local area and further afield with the ambition being to introduce international field trips in the coming years.
